Winter sports in Utah are world famous. With most of the resorts are centrally located. Eleven world-class ski resorts are within 55 minutes of downtown and The Grand America Hotel.  
 
Champagne Featherlight Powder
Utah’s Feather-light snow (some have called it the Greatest Snow on Earth) is almost unbelievable. The beautiful Rocky Mountains provide not only excellent ski runs but glorious scenery as well. Most ski resorts have state-of-the-art facilities including high-speed lifts, quad chairs and snow-making equipment.

Olympic-Class Skiing
The 2002 Olympic Winter Games took place at 14 venues in and around Salt Lake City. Try your skill at the Olympic downhill course located at Snowbasin, our sister property. Considered one of the fastest and most difficult downhill courses anywhere, you can test your prowess against that of the Olympic champions.
